**Te Whiwhinga mahi | The opportunity**

We are looking for a **Research Communications Adviser** to join the University’s Central Communications team, to develop and communicate the value, relevance, and excellence of the University’s research to public audiences, key stakeholders and media in alignment with Taumata Teitei, the University’s Vision 2030 and Strategic Plan 2025.

You will be working collaboratively with institute researchers and Large-Scale Research Institute (ABI and Liggins) communications staff to identify and develop story ideas for public audiences that will enhance the University’s research reputation. You will be responsible for identifying key experts who are able to offer expertise, analysis and commentary on major and persistent societal challenges.

This role involves working cross functionally with the central media adviser team, University research centres and faculty research centres to identify research initiatives and expertise relevant to public audiences and key stakeholders. You will be working with the Research Communications Manager to support research communications strategy initiatives.

This is a **full-time** (37.5 hours per week), **permanent** opportunity.
The remuneration for this role is $78,500 - $97,000 per annum, dependent on skills and experience.

**He kōrero mōu | About you**

To be successful in this role, you will have:

- Suitable Tertiary Qualification such as Communications, Public Relations or Journalism.
- 5-10 years’ experience as a senior journalist or communications professional, with an eye for a good story and track record in researching and writing long form content.
- Strong, versatile writing skills and an ability to tailor writing styles to different channels.
- Experience writing for web and digital channels.
- Excellent writing, proofreading and fact-checking skills
- Excellent verbal communication skills
